Our cat gave birth today - she's not meant to be a pet, really for killing mice, but wangled her way in. She is cosily established in a laying box in the henhouse with her babies. The problem is that her grownup son has regressed and is now also suckling. Should I take him away? Will the babies suffer if he stays? Pat.

Yes I'd take him away, he has no need to suckle and your cat will produce enough milk for the new kits but not for some grown up gullump to have a snack as well.  I'm surprised she hasn't told him where to go though.
